Your microbiome runs the show.
Trillions of microorganisms in your gut regulate immunity, metabolism, mood, and skin. The gut is the command centre to more than just digestion. Learn why you can benefit from a happy, healthy gut.
Around 70% of immune activity lives in the gut and about 90% of the body's serotonin is produced there.
What does this mean? A well-functioning gut absorbs nutrients, regulates immune response, produces neurotransmitters, supports hormonal balance, and keeps inflammation in check.
